Transaction 259612cd31d250f5871277963ead7f5e5cc049a2ccdf0a214aefe957c9294200
1 Input
1 Output
-
259612cd31d250f5871277963ead7f5e5cc049a2ccdf0a214aefe957c9294200:0
- value
- 395639
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d72f830e2bc7328b8b3cb34044e74840fd149832 OP_EQUAL
- address
- 3MJp7yUAoSi9ZDrPf8T8i7puLaLWrtAoFo